Manchester United will have €75 million for winter transfer window

Manchester United are gearing up for the winter transfer window by sorting out their budget first. Ralf Rangnick is set to work with a €76.5 million budget in his first transfer window in charge of the Red Devils. 

But, the German will only be allowed to work with that kind of a budget if he lets go of his fringe players. The team needs to be rebuilt after a very difficult start to the season. The squad is unbalanced, and Rangnick is expected to add some level of stability to the team.

They will need new players to truly challenge for the top four places, with the kind of quality that the league currently has. 

Which Manchester United fringe players will be sold?

Jesse Lingard and Anthony Martial are two of the players that are headed out in the January transfer window. 

Martial has been on the radar of Barcelona for the last few months, and could finally make the move away from United when the transfer window opens up for business. Sevilla and  Newcastle United have also emerged as potential destinations for the Frenchman. 

Jesse Lingard spent the latter half of the previous season on loan at West Ham United. And now, it seems that this season could end with a loan spell for him as well. The midfielder has not agreed to a new deal and will leave Manchester United at the end of the season. 

Second-choice goalkeeper Dean Henderson could also be on his way out of the club. David De Gea seems to be the first preference for Ralf Rangnick, and the Englishman is potentially on his way out to Ajax.
